Murder probe launched after fatal stabbing

DETECTIVES have launched a murder investigation after a man was stabbed during a disturbance outside a public house in Rochester.

Police and an ambulance crew were called to The Vineyard pub in the city's Maidstone Road at about 7.15pm on New Year's Eve. The 29-year-old victim, Marco Schirolli, of Copperfield Road, Rochester, was taken to Gillingham's Medway Maritime Hospital where he later died.

Police would like to speak to three men who were seen having a minor argument with Mr Schirolli earlier in the evening. One is between 30 to 40 years old, white, slim, about 6ft tall and wearing a black leather jacket, jeans and a fleece underneath the jacket.

The second man was white, heavily built, in his 30s, and wore a black waist length leather jacket, light blue shirt and black trousers. The third man was white, is aged about 30, 5ft 7ins tall, and stocky. He was wearing a black puffa jacket and grey and white Nike trainers.

The police have dubbed the investigation Operation Adept. Anyone with information is asked to contact police on 01634 827055, ext 2611
